About the Role
The analyst will partner with local and regional IT teams to deliver daily support for the office and provide helpdesk assistance to end‑users across the firm. • Provide support on corporate IT Helpdesk • Install new printers, copiers, plotters, and other office equipment • Install and support enterprise applications • Perform data maintenance and archiving • Assist with office moves and expansions

What You Bring
Candidates should hold a Bachelor’s degree in IT, Computer Science or a related field with 0‑2 years experience, or an Associate’s degree with 3+ years experience, and possess knowledge of Windows 10, Office 365, Teams, OneDrive, Exchange 365, Windows Server, Active Directory and basic networking.

Benefits
The role offers a salary range of $70,000‑$75,000 and may require travel to other regional offices as needed. • 2‑to‑1 company match up to 4% of compensation plus profit sharing • Low‑cost medical, dental, and vision insurance • Personal leave, flexible scheduling, floating holidays, half‑day Fridays • Student loan matching in 401(k) and performance bonuses • Tuition reimbursement and extensive internal training • New parent leave, family‑building benefits, childcare resources
